First and foremost, let’s talk about the materials you will need to make your own bean bags. The main components of a bean bag are the outer cover and the filling. For the outer cover, you can use a variety of fabrics such as cotton, denim, or even faux fur, depending on your preference. Make sure to choose a durable fabric that can withstand regular use and the weight of the filling. As for the filling, the most common and cost-effective option is polystyrene beads, which are lightweight and mold to the shape of your body. You can also use shredded foam, memory foam, or even dried beans or rice as alternative fillings.

Once you have gathered all the materials, it’s time to start making your bean bags. The first step is to cut the fabric into two identical pieces, each in the shape of a large circle. You can use a compass or a circular object as a template to ensure the circles are uniform in size. The diameter of the circles will determine the size of your bean bags, so make sure to measure and cut them according to your desired dimensions.

Next, place the two fabric circles on top of each other with the right sides facing inwards. Sew around the edges of the circles, leaving a small opening for turning and filling later. Make sure to reinforce the seams by backstitching at the beginning and end of the stitching. Once you have sewn the edges together, turn the fabric inside out so the right sides are facing outwards.

Now it’s time to fill the bean bag with your chosen filling. Using a funnel or a makeshift funnel made from a piece of paper, carefully pour the filling into the opening of the bean bag. Be careful not to overfill the bean bag, as this can make it too stiff and uncomfortable to sit on. Leave some room for the filling to move around and conform to your body when you sit on the bean bag.

After filling the bean bag to your desired level of firmness, it’s time to close the opening. You can hand sew the opening shut using a needle and thread, or you can use a sewing machine for a quicker and more secure closure. Make sure to stitch the opening closed tightly to prevent any filling from leaking out.
